Emerging Logic: The Transforming Role of Emotional Intelligence in AI

The realm of artificial intelligence is rapidly pushing the boundaries of what's possible. While logic and computational prowess have traditionally shaped AI, a novel shift is underway: the integration of emotional intelligence. This movement signals a departure from purely deterministic systems, envisioning AI that can interpret and respond to human emotions in meaningful ways.

As this integration, AI systems could attain a deeper level of insight into the complexities of human behavior, laying the way for more productive interactions and applications across diverse fields.

  • Consider AI-powered therapists that can deliver empathetic guidance, or learning platforms that cater to individual student emotions
  • Moreover, consider the potential of AI in mediation, where its ability to analyze emotional cues could foster peaceful outcomes.

This shift, however, presents unique challenges. Training AI systems that can effectively understand and engage with human emotions requires refined algorithms, comprehensive training data, and continuous assessment.

In spite of these challenges, the potential of AI-powered emotional intelligence is truly remarkable. As research develops and technology evolves, we can look forward to a future where AI becomes a more compassionate partner in our lives.

The Pursuit of Sentience: Can AI Understand Emotions?

Artificial intelligence has made leaps and bounds, blurring the lines between machine and human. While AI excels in logical tasks, replicating the complexities of human emotional intelligence remains a formidable challenge. Can algorithms truly perceive emotions like joy, sorrow, or anger? Or are these experiences uniquely sentient?

Some researchers posit that AI could one day simulate emotional intelligence through advanced models. These systems could learn to analyze human facial expressions, tone of voice, and textual cues, allowing them to engage in a more emotionally aware manner.

However, others express concern that true emotional intelligence may be inherently human. They emphasize the subjective and complex nature of emotions, which are often shaped by personal experiences, cultural beliefs, and unconscious instincts.
